硬件编程是计算机科学和电子工程领域的交叉学科,对于想要入门硬件编程的人来说,选择合适的在线学习资源至关重要。以下是对十大权威硬件编程学习网站的排名解析,帮助新手快速找到适合自己的学习路径。
1. Arduino.cc
Arduino是一个开源电子原型平台,适合初学者入门。Arduino.cc提供了丰富的教程、代码示例和社区支持,是学习Arduino编程的理想之地。
特色:
- 官方教程,系统全面
- 社区活跃,问题解答快
- 丰富的项目案例
2. EEWeb
EEWeb是一个专注于嵌入式系统、物联网和硬件编程的社区平台,提供了大量的学习资源和项目案例。
特色:
- 涵盖多个硬件编程领域
- 项目案例丰富,实用性强
- 定期举办线上研讨会
3. Raspberry Pi官网
Raspberry Pi是一款低成本的微型计算机,适合学习Linux操作系统和硬件编程。官网提供了详细的教程和资源。
特色:
- 官方支持,资料权威
- 适合初学者到进阶者
- 丰富的项目案例
4. Microchip Developer Center
Microchip公司提供了一系列微控制器和开发工具,其官网提供了丰富的学习资源和开发套件。
特色:
- 官方资源,技术支持
- 针对不同微控制器提供详细教程
- 开发工具和软件支持
5. All About Circuits
All About Circuits是一个电子工程领域的在线学习平台,提供了大量的电路设计教程和案例。
特色:
- 电路设计基础教程
- 丰富的案例库
- 社区讨论活跃
6. Hackaday
Hackaday是一个电子爱好者和硬件开发者社区,提供了大量的项目案例和教程。
特色:
- 项目案例创新,实用性强
- 社区讨论活跃,问题解答快
- 定期举办Hackaday Prize比赛
7. SparkFun Electronics
SparkFun是一家提供电子元器件和开发工具的公司,其官网提供了丰富的学习资源和教程。
特色:
- 提供多种语言教程
- 开发工具和元器件支持
- 丰富的项目案例
8. Elektor Labs
Elektor Labs是一个电子工程领域的在线实验室,提供了大量的教程和项目案例。
特色:
- 实验室环境,动手能力强
- 适合进阶学习者
- 案例丰富,涉及多个领域
9. Coursera
Coursera是一个在线学习平台,提供了来自世界顶级大学的硬件编程课程。
特色:
- 名校课程,质量有保障
- 多种语言授课
- 可获得官方证书
10. edX
edX是一个在线学习平台,提供了来自世界顶级大学的硬件编程课程。
特色:
- 名校课程,质量有保障
- 多种语言授课
- 可获得官方证书
总结:以上十大权威学习网站涵盖了硬件编程的各个方面,从入门到进阶,从理论学习到实践操作,都能找到适合自己的学习资源。希望这篇文章能为硬件编程入门者提供一些帮助。
